offera.io
2固件工程师
C语言程序设计/指针基础/指针的算术运算

p++和++p有什么区别?

题目摘要

固件工程师面试题:p++和++p有什么区别?重点考察前缀和后缀自增运算符在指针操作中的执行顺序差异。可结合建议对比说明: 1. 先解释p++:先用后加 2. 再解释++p:先加后用 3. 用代码示例验证差异来组织回答。

  • 岗位方向:固件工程师
  • 所属章节:C语言程序设计
  • 当前小节:指针的算术运算
  • 考察重点:前缀和后缀自增运算符在指针操作中的执行顺序差异。
  • 作答建议:建议对比说明: 1. 先解释p++:先用后加 2. 再解释++p:先加后用 3. 用代码示例验证差异

考察要点

前缀和后缀自增运算符在指针操作中的执行顺序差异。

答题思路

建议对比说明: 1. 先解释p++:先用后加 2. 再解释++p:先加后用 3. 用代码示例验证差异

这道题的参考答案包含了详细的分析和要点总结。点击下方按钮查看完整答案。

答案经过精心组织,帮助你建立系统化的知识框架。